About
A PEG-60 castor oil derivative — a mild emulsifier and oil solubilizer used in cleansers and lotions. Safe at cosmetic levels when supplier purifies PEG residuals.
Function
Skin benefits
- Effective non-ionic emulsifier and solubilizer
- Helps disperse oils in water-based products
- Mild on skin in rinse-off
- Compatible with fragrance solubilization
Known concerns
- PEG class — small risk of 1,4-dioxane/ethylene oxide impurities if not purified
- Avoid on broken skin
